dual specificity testis-specific protein kinase 2; testicular protein kinase 2 (TESK2)
Function:
- dual specificity protein kinase activity catalyzing autophosphorylation & phosphorylation of exogenous substrates on both Ser/Thr & Tyr
- phosphorylates cofilin at Ser-3
- may play an role in spermatogenesis
- activated by autophosphorylation on Ser-219
ATP + a protein = ADP + a phosphoprotein
Cofactor: Mg+2, Mn+2 (putative)
Structure:
- belongs to the protein kinase superfamily, TKL Ser/Thr protein kinase family
- contains 1 protein kinase domain
Compartment: nucleus
Alternative splicing: named isoforms=3
Expression:
- predominantly expressed in testis & prostate
- found predominantly in non-germinal Sertoli cells
